New Diastereoselective Route to 2-Substitutedcis-(2S,5S)- andtrans-(2S,5R)-5-Alkylpyrrolidines as Indolizidine and Pyrrolizidine Scaffolds

A new and short stereoselective route to the synthesis of enantiopure cis-2,5-disubstituted pyrrolidines as indolizidine or pyrrolizidine scaffolds has been developed. The method, which uses (S)-pyroglutamic acid as a chiral starting material, is based on the ring opening of N-protected γ-lactams by alkyl phenyl sulfone carbanions, followed by desulfonylation and reductive amination of alkyl γ-amino
